NCP promised to produce two IAS in its Manifesto

In the manifesto of the Nationalist Congress Party (NCP), it has mention to approach the Supreme Court’s for intervention to solve the long pending inter-state boundary dispute with Assam.

The most interesting part about the manifesto is that it promises that NCP MLA’s should fund two students per year to become IAS officers from the State. It also promises to set up education policy by emphasizing more on skill development.

The NCP talked about framing of state mining policy, setting up of anti-corruption vigilance commission, pursue Majithia Wage Board recommendation for benefits of journalists, strengthen border areas and empower border people economically, set up international markets to encourage border trade with neighbouring countries, upgrade existing infrastructure like Umroi Airport Khasi Hills and Baljek Airport, introduce railway lines along with strong preventive measures against influx, improve road infrastructure in rural areas without compromising quality.

Narendra Modi take a jibe at Mukul Sangma

Modi during his rally in Phulbari West Garo Hills remind the crowd that his Government at the centre has been engaging in various rescue operations of the people of the Christian Community who got trapped in the clutches of terrorists in countries like Iraq and Afghanistan. Her cite example of Father Tom Uzhunnalil, a catholic priest from Kerala who was kidnapped by Islamic Terrorists in 2016, Narendra Modi said, “Father Tom, in Yaman who was spreading the message of Christianity was kidnapped by the terrorists. The Indian Government made tireless efforts day and night to rescue him and we also urged to those nations, which had cordial relationship with Yamen to save Father Tom. We successfully freed Father Tom and got him back. His heath was deteriorating and we provided his medical care as well.”

He also reminds the people of how his Government rescue 46 nurses from the hands of militants in Afghanistan in July 2014. Prime Minister Modi, whose party is often blamed for Pro-Hindu stands, blamed Chief Minister Mukul Sangma for communal politics saying that Dr. Sangma does not believe in taking everyone along in the path of development.

He also announced Rs. 180 crore for renovation of the Shillong Airport, Houses for the landless, heath insurance worth Rs. 5 lakhs for each person among others. He attacked Chief Minister Mukul Sangma for family centric politics. “Meghalaya has become the property for the Congress party as all the members including his wife to his brother in law is fighting the election. Had he has a grandson, he would have also stand him in the polls”, he said.

PAYA TAKU from India wins gold in “International Wushu Championship” in Moscow

Arunachal Paya Taku got the privilege to represent the country in the girl’s category of the “International Wushu Championship”in Moscow, Russia which was held from 17th to 21st February. Taku took part in the girls’ 48 kg category and won gold medal.  She is a regular trainee of Sangay Lhaden Sports Academy under the guidance of coach M. Premchandra Singh. She took part in the special coaching camp at SAI Centre, Imphal from 15th January to 15th February. Taku has bagged numerous medals for the state in the past and is expected to bring laurels for the country in the championship. Meanwhile, All Arunachal Pradesh Wushu Association President, Toko Teki, Sports Director, Tadar Appa, Sangay Lhaden Sports Academy Principal, Tabia Chobin and others have wished Taku for her bright future and success in the competition.

Nongstoin get its District and Session Court

Chief Justice of Meghalaya High Court, Justice Tarun Agarwala inaugurated the permanent office building of the District and Session Court at Mawiong Pyndengrei, Nongstoiñ in West Khasi Hills district. In his inaugural address, the Chief Justice said that people of the area can come forward and sought legal advices and suggestions from the court, and called upon the judicial officers and staffs to extend their services for the benefit of the general masses and ensure that justice is done.

‘Modi is the investment of corruption’- Rahul Gandhi

Indian National Congress (INC) Chief Rahul Gandhi lashed out to the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) in particularly the honourable Prime Minister Narendra Modi for their huge investment of money toward the upcoming election in the state. While addressing the public in Police Bazar Shillong Rahul Gandhi said that the money that BJP spend for the campaign in the state comes from the likes of Nirav Modi and Vijay Mallaya who have silently loot and convert all the ‘black money’ into ‘white money’. He added that BJP have huge sum of money and they are trying to buy votes and MLA in Meghalaya just like they did in Manipur and Goa.  When asked about the Punjab National Bank (PNB) scam, Rahul Gandhi said that Narendra Modi is behind the success of Nirav Modi  to run away with 22,000 crore to England.

Rahul Gandhi accused Narendra Modi of shielding the corrupt business men with huge chunk of black money by saying that “Modi is not actually against corruption, He is corruption, and he is the investment of corruption.”

While urging the people of the state to vote for Congress, Rahul Gandhi said “Congress party is made up of the spirit and freedom of millions of people in this country and it doesn’t matter have much money you have”.

UDP Umroi Circle Meeting

The United Democratic Party Umroi circle lead by its candidate Mangkara Pathaw today organised a public meeting at Mawpun village to educate the electorate regarding the objectives of the 2018 Legislative Election. The meeting was attended by eminent political leaders including Former Chief Minister and retired politician J.D Rymbai, former M.LA S.W Rymbai, former M.D.C Fabian Lyngdoh, H.Marwein and sitting MDC  and candidate from Umroi constituency Don Sumer.

Speaking during the meeting candidate of Umroi Constituency Don Sumer lashed out to NPP candidate Ngaitlang Dhar for not delivering what has been promised to the people. He accused Ngaitlang of using money power to buy electorates from the constituency. Don Sumer urged the people not to fall prey on any candidates who offer money for their support. He also lashed out to the Mukul Sangma-led Congress Government for its failure in tackling scams in the state especially with the recruitment of teachers and police.

The UDP candidate from Umroi Constituency Mangkara Pathaw has promise to look into the grievances of the Youth, Health, the agriculture community and education if he is voted to power.
